This video tutorial provides solutions to a calculus derivative quiz, covering various differentiation techniques such as implicit differentiation, quotient rule, chain rule, and derivatives of inverse trigonometric functions. The instructor explains each problem step-by-step, offering insights into common mistakes and tips for solving similar problems.
